Almost but not quite

An area just off the North/South Carolina coasts has begun to organize, but probably won’t before moving inland. At the moment, the NHC is assigning a zero percent probability for the area of storms to become a tropical depression.

This does not mean that there’s a zero percent chance of rain from this storm system. It extends down the coast and along the Georgia and Florida coast to Jacksonville. The rain we had yesterday was from this storm system, and we should have a bit more today.

There’s nothing really unexpected or dangerous. Just watch out for sudden rain.
